AI summary

This proposal seeks to establish a bug bounty program for thUSD, a new product within the Threshold Network. It aims to incentivize security experts, known as 'white hats,' to find and report vulnerabilities in thUSD. The program will collaborate with Immunefi, a web3 bug bounty platform, and will offer rewards in T tokens for critical, high, medium, and low-severity bugs, with critical bugs potentially receiving up to $100,000.

Impact

If approved, this program will enhance the security of the upcoming thUSD product by proactively identifying and fixing potential vulnerabilities, benefiting all users of thUSD. The DAO's treasury will be used to fund the bug bounties, with specific amounts to be determined by a working group.

Dear Threshold Community,

As part of our commitment to maintaining the highest standards of security and reliability for the Threshold Network and its associated products, we are proposing the establishment of a public bug bounty program for the thUSD product that will be launched soon. This program aims to enhance the security posture of the network by incentivizing security experts to identify and responsibly disclose vulnerabilities.
